WisdomTree amends Bitcoin ETF application, naming US Bank as custodian

New York-based asset manager WisdomTree has amended its filing for a Bitcoin exchange-traded fund with the Securities and Exchange Commission to name U.S. Bank as its custodian.  In a Wednesday filing, WisdomTree listed U.S. Bank National Association as the custodian for shares of its Bitcoin (BTC) trust. MicroStrategy purchases $82M in Bitcoin, now holds 122,478 coins

Business intelligence firm MicroStrategy has added 1,434 Bitcoin to its coffers after purchasing the crypto asset at an average price of $57,477. According to a Thursday filing with the Securities and Exchange Commission, MicroStrategy purchased 1,434 Bitcoin (BTC) between Nov. 29 and Dec. 8 for roughly $82.4 million, making its total holdings 122,478 BTC. US lawmaker purchases exposure to Bitcoin through Grayscale shares

Illinois Representative Marie Newman has disclosed she purchased up to $50,000 in exposure to crypto through shares of Grayscale Bitcoin Trust. According to a financial disclosure report filed with the U.S. House of Representatives on Dec. 8, Congressperson Newman bought between $15,001 and $50,000 of GBTC between Nov. 9 and Dec. 4.
